JNTUH M.Tech 2017-2018 (R17) Detailed Syllabus Water Quality Modelling

Water Quality Modelling Detailed Syllabus for Environmental Engineering M.Tech first year second sem is covered here. This gives the details about credits, number of hours and other details along with reference books for the course.

The detailed syllabus for Water Quality Modelling M.Tech 2017-2018 (R17) first year second sem is as follows.

M.Tech. I Year II Sem.

Course Objective: To develop a mathematical approach towards modelling of various mechanisms related to sustenance of quality of water

Course Outcomes:

  • An outlook on water quality monitoring.
  • Mathematical modelling dealing with various aspects like transport mechanisms. pollution from different sources etc.
  • A brief outlook on legislations related to maintenance of water quality.

UNIT- I: Introduction: Water Quality, Water quality characteristics, sampling and analysis, Analytical methods, Automated analysis and remote monitoring.

UNIT- II: Water quality monitoring: Water Pollution, Sources of Pollution, Nature of pollutants, Existing Approaches for Control/ – Abatement of Water Quality Degradation, Water Quality Monitoring in River Basins

UNIT- III: Water quality modeling: Modelling and Monitoring, Evolution of Water Quality Models, Types of Water Quality Models, DO and BOD in streams, Transformation and transport processes, Oxygen transfer, Turbulent mixing, Non-Point Source Pollution, Modelling Approaches For Modeling Non-point Sources.

UNIT- IV: Water Quality Management: Water quality objectives and standards, Water quality control models, Flow augmentation, River and Lake water quality Models, Groundwater quality Models, Wastewater Transport Systems.

UNIT- V: Legal Aspects of Water quality: Water pollution control acts and Legislation.

TEXT BOOKS:

  • Tebutt, T. H. Y., (1998), “Principles of Water Quality Control”, Pergamon Press, Oxford
  • Gerard Kiely, (1998), “Environmental Engineering”, McGraw Hill Publications
  • Viessman, W. Jr. and M. J. Hammer (1985), “Water Supply and Pollution Control”, Harper and Row Publishers, New York.
  • Jerald L. Schnoor, (1996), “Environmental Modeling – Fate and Transport of Pollutants in Water, Air and Soil”, John Wiley & Sons Inc., New York.
